Molecular mechanisms of bone 18F-NaF deposition
Johannes Czernin1, Nagichettiar Satyamurthy, Christiaan Schiepers
1Ahmanson Biological Imaging Division, Department of Molecular and Medical Pharmacology, David Geffen School of Medicine, University of California, Los Angeles, CA 90095-1782, USA. jczernin@mednet.ucla.edu
Abstract:
There is renewed interest in (18)F-NaF bone imaging with PET or PET/CT. The current brief discussion focuses on the molecular mechanisms of (18)F-NaF deposition in bone and presents model-based approaches to quantifying bone perfusion and metabolism in the context of preclinical and clinical applications of bone imaging with PET.
